Materials of high-quality
A high-quality double glazed window is an important element of the design of a home. It can add to the beauty of your home, increase its historic value and contribute to the local character.
Many of Bristol's oldest houses still have original timber windows with sash. These windows typically have original Crown glass as well as period fittings and seasoned timber. A replacement window, even if it's an exact copy, could destroy this historic fabric and alter the style of the building.

There are many kinds of glazing. This includes low-emissivity glass often referred to as 'Low E' glass. This glass is best for homes in more cold climates. It lets natural light through but blocks sun's heat from entering your home.
Safety glass is another choice for double-glazed windows. It's designed to be safer to break than regular glass, because it breaks into smaller pieces. It's also more resistant to heat than regular glass.
Other kinds of glazing include acoustic or 'Acoustic', glass, that is designed to block out unwanted noise from the outside world. This glass is bonded with an acoustic interlayer that weakens the sound waves. It's an excellent choice for older buildings that require to reduce noise levels in the living areas.
